/* Medium Layout: 1280px. */

@media only screen and (min-width: 992px) and (max-width: 1200px) {
	
    .mainmenu ul li a {
        padding: 25px 15px;
    }
  
}


/* Tablet Layout: 768px. */

@media only screen and (min-width: 768px) and (max-width: 991px) {
	.work-filter {
        margin-bottom: 30px;
    }
    section#why-choose:after {
        width: 40%;
    }
    .team-image img {
        width: 100%;
    }
    .navbar .navbar-collapse {
        opacity: 0.9;
        max-height: 500px;
        overflow: hidden;
        background: #FFF;
        text-align: center;
        padding: 10px 0;
    }
}


/* Mobile Layout: 320px. */

@media only screen and (max-width: 767px) {
	.hero-text h1 {
        font-size: 30px;
    }
    .hero-text h2 {
        font-size: 25px;
    }
    .logo {
        margin-top: 0;
    }
    header#header {
        padding: 10px 0;
    }
    .navbar {
        padding: 0px;
        margin-top: 5px !important;
    }
    .navbar-light .navbar-toggler {
        border-color: #6d6e71;
    }
    .navbar .navbar-collapse {
        opacity: 0.9;
        max-height: 500px;
        overflow: hidden;
        background: #FFF;
        text-align: center;
        padding: 10px 0;
    }
    nav.navbar.navbar-expand-lg.navbar-light.bg-light {
        margin-top: 10px;
    }
    .sticky-header .navbar-light .navbar-toggler {
        border-color: #333;
    }
    .sticky-header .navbar-light .navbar-toggler i.fa{
       color: #333;
    }
    .sticky-header .mainmenu ul li a {
        color: #fff !important;
    }
    div#navbarNav ul li a {
        padding: 10px 0 !important;
    }
    .nav-pills .nav-link {
        font-size: 14px;
        padding: 10px 6px;
    }
    .section-title-heading h1 {
        font-size: 25px;
    }
    .counter-item {
        text-align: center;
    }
    section#why-choose:after {
        position: inherit;
    }
    #alive-testimonial .owl-nav div{
        display: none !important;
    }
    #alive-slider-area .owl-nav div {
        left: 40px;
    }
    #alive-slider-area .owl-nav div.owl-next {
        right: 40px;
    }
    .normal-header .navbar-light .navbar-toggler {
        border-color: #333;
    }
    .normal-header button.navbar-toggler i.fa {
        color: #333;
    }
    .normal-header .mainmenu ul li a {
        color: #fff !important;
    }
    .single-work-box img {
        width: 100%;
    }
    .team-image img {
        width: 100%;
    }

    .blog-thumbni img {
        width: 100%;
    }
    #alive-slider-area .owl-nav div {
        display: none !important;
    }
    #why-choose:after {
        display: none;
    }
    #why-choose .col-xl-6.col-xl-6.col-lg-6.col-md-7.pd-120px {
        padding-top: 120px;
        padding-bottom: 120px;
        padding-right: 15px;
        padding-left: 15px;
    }
    .work-filter {
        margin-bottom: 30px;
    }
    .contact-info {
        margin-bottom: 30px;
    }
    #awards {
        display: none;
    }    

    #m-awards {
        display: block;
    }    
    
}


/* Wide Mobile Layout: 480px. */

@media only screen and (min-width: 480px) and (max-width: 767px) {
	.container {
        width: 450px
        /*width: 100%*/
    }  
}
